DOCM is a file format similar to DOCX but allows the inclusion of macros. Macros are scripts or code snippets that automate tasks within the document. DOCM files are commonly used when document automation is required, such as in complex spreadsheets or forms.
HTML (Hypertext Markup Language) is the standard markup language for creating web pages and web applications. It defines the structure of content within a web page using markup tags, which describe the layout, formatting, and interactive elements of the page.
